Cunard Commences 175th Anniversary Year with Spectacular Start


Cunard has commenced its 175th anniversary year with a spectacular start, as fireworks and marching bands marked the departure of Queen Mary 2 and Queen Elizabeth on their World Voyages this weekend.
A magnificent year of celebrations is planned, with special features on board, a top-flight line-up of celebrity speakers and a series of World Class events and commemorative sailings in place for 2015.
Flagship Queen Mary 2 and sister ship Queen Elizabeth took centre stage in Southampton on Saturday as the two Queens embarked on their 2015 World Voyages. Joining guests on board were acclaimed British actress, Celia Imrie (aboard Queen Mary 2), and former chief news correspondent for the BBC, Kate Adie (aboard Queen Elizabeth), as part of Cunard’s acclaimed Insights speaker programme, featuring high-calibre presenters throughout the year.   Further leading lights, including statesmen, authors, actresses, poets and politicians, will share their knowledge, stories and experiences with passengers on board Cunard’s ships during this anniversary year.
The 175th anniversary will be celebrated across all three Cunard ships during the year, with
•           Gala dinners with souvenir menus on cruises of more than four nights
•           “Black, Red and Gold” themed Balls in the Queens Room aboard each ship
•           175th themed commemorative drinks, from special blends of wine to craft beers, plus 175th themed cakes and deserts at afternoon tea and formal dinners.
•           Themed entertainment, including 175th anniversary quizzes and the quirky side of Cunard’s history presented by the RADA theatre group travelling aboard Queen Mary 2’s transatlantic crossings
•           Specially created 175th merchandise, from collectible posters to teddy bears and polo shirts to cufflinks and 18 carat Clogue gold jewellery
•           Mail posted on board with be over-stamped with the 175th anniversary logo
•           In cabin stationery – postcards, writing paper and envelopes – will display the 175th anniversary logo
